AGENTS.md — AI Agent Operating Standards
This file defines the operational principles, architecture, and collaboration standards for all AI agents working on this project. It is platform-agnostic and applies equally whether the agent is Claude (Anthropic), Gemini (Google), OpenCode, or any other AI coding assistant. Read this file in full at the start of every session, before any code is written or tools are built.

🏗️ Phase 1: B — Blueprint (Vision & Logic)
Discovery: At project start, ask the user the following 5 questions:
- North Star: What is the singular desired outcome?
- Integrations: Which external services are needed? Are credentials ready?
- Source of Truth: Where does the primary data live?
- Delivery Payload: How and where should the final result be delivered?
- Behavioral Rules: How should the system act? (tone, logic constraints, “Do Not” rules)
Data-First Rule: Define the JSON Data Schema (input/output shapes) before any coding begins. Coding only starts once the payload shape is confirmed.
